1. Complete Blood Count (CBC)

A Complete Blood Count (CBC) is one of the most commonly prescribed blood tests.

What It Checks

This test evaluates several components of your blood, including:

  • Red blood cells
  • White blood cells
  • Hemoglobin
  • Platelets
  • Hematocrit

Why It Is Done

Doctors often recommend a CBC test to detect:

  • Anemia
  • Infections
  • Immune disorders
  • Blood disorders

Since this test only requires a small blood sample, it can easily be done through home sample collection services in India.

4. Liver Function Test (LFT)

The Liver Function Test helps evaluate the health of your liver.

Parameters Checked

This test usually measures:

  • ALT
  • AST
  • Bilirubin
  • Alkaline phosphatase
  • Albumin

When It Is Needed

Doctors may suggest an LFT if a patient has:

  • Jaundice
  • Fatty liver
  • Alcohol-related liver damage
  • Medication side effects

Today, many healthcare providers offer LFT blood tests at home in India, making regular liver monitoring easier.

6. Blood Sugar Tests

Blood sugar testing is essential for diagnosing and managing diabetes, which affects millions of people in India.

Common Blood Sugar Tests

These include:

  • Fasting Blood Sugar (FBS)
  • Postprandial Blood Sugar (PPBS)
  • HbA1c Test

Importance

These tests help doctors:

  • Diagnose diabetes
  • Monitor blood sugar levels
  • Adjust medications

Since diabetes requires regular monitoring, home blood testing services are extremely convenient for patients.

How Home Blood Sample Collection Works in India

Many people wonder whether home testing is reliable. Fortunately, the process is safe and highly standardized.

Step 1: Book the Test

Patients can schedule the test through:

  • Healthcare apps
  • Websites
  • Phone calls

Step 2: Home Visit by Phlebotomist

A trained technician visits your home with:

  • Sterile needles
  • Collection tubes
  • Protective equipment

Step 3: Sample Collection

The blood sample is collected safely in just a few minutes.

Step 4: Lab Testing

The sample is transported to a certified diagnostic laboratory for analysis.

Step 5: Digital Reports

Finally, patients receive reports through:

  • Email
  • Mobile app
  • WhatsApp

Tips Before a Home Blood Test

To ensure accurate results, follow these simple tips.

Follow Fasting Instructions

Some tests require fasting before blood tests, such as lipid profiles and fasting blood sugar tests, require 8–12 hours of fasting.

Stay Hydrated

Drinking water before a blood test helps with easier sample collection.

Inform About Medications

Always inform the technician if you are taking medications.

Choose a Trusted Service

Ensure that the provider uses NABL-certified laboratories for testing.

Frequently Asked Questions on Blood test at home?

1. What blood tests can be done at home in India?

Common home blood tests include CBC, thyroid profile, lipid profile, liver function, kidney function, and diabetes tests.

2. Is home blood sample collection safe in India?

Yes, trained phlebotomists use sterile equipment and follow medical safety standards for safe home blood sample collection.

3. How do I book a blood test at home in India?

You can book home blood tests online through healthcare websites, apps, or by calling diagnostic labs offering home sample collection.

4. How long does it take to get blood test reports?

Most home blood test reports are delivered digitally within 24–48 hours depending on the test type.

5. Do I need to fast before a home blood test?

Yes, some tests like lipid profile and fasting blood sugar require 8–12 hours of fasting for accurate results.

6. Are home blood tests accurate?

Yes, samples collected at home are tested in certified laboratories, ensuring the same accuracy as lab-based tests.

7. Can senior citizens get blood tests at home?

Yes, home blood testing is ideal for elderly patients who may find it difficult to travel to diagnostic centers.

8. What is the cost of a blood test at home in India?

Home blood test costs vary by test but usually range between ₹200 and ₹2000 depending on the diagnostic package.

9. Can diabetes tests be done at home?

Yes, fasting blood sugar, postprandial sugar, and HbA1c tests can all be done through home sample collection.

10. Who should consider home blood testing services?

Home blood tests are ideal for elderly patients, busy professionals, chronic disease patients, and preventive health checkups.
